2018/19 English Premier League – Round 12 – The City of Manchester gets a ‘Blue’ paint

Cardiff City 2–1 Brighton & Hove Albion
Cardiff City – Callum Paterson 28’ Souleymane Bamba 90+1’
Brighton & Hove Albion – Lewis Dunk 6’

Huddersfield Town 1–1 West Ham United
Huddersfield Town – Alex Pritchard 6
West Ham United – Felipe Anderson 74’

Leicester City 0–0 Burnley

Newcastle United 2–1 AFC Bournemouth
Newcastle United – Jose Salomon Rondon 7’ 40’
AFC Bournemouth – Jefferson Lerma 45+6’

Southampton 1–1 Watford
Southampton – Manolo Gabbiadini 20’
Watford – Jose Holebas 82’

Crystal Palace 0-1 Tottenham
Tottenham – Juan Foyth 66’

November 11, 2018
Liverpool 2–0 Fulham
Liverpool – Mohamed Salah 41’ Xherdan Shaqiri 53’

Chelsea 0–0 Everton

Arsenal 1–1 Wolverhampton
Arsenal – Henrikh Mkhitaryan 86’
Wolverhampton – Ivan Cavaleiro 13’

Manchester City 3–1 Manchester United
Manchester City – David Silva 12’ Sergio Aguero 48’ Ilkay Gundogan 86’
Manchester United – Anthony Martial 58’(pen)

Felipe Anderson’s equalizing goal for West Ham United ended up denying Huddersfield Town from making it a consecutive league victory after getting their first victory of the season.

Unlike Huddersfield Town, Newcastle United made it a consecutive league victory after going winless in their opening 10 league matches. Salomon Rondon netted in two goals to help Newcastle United to a ‘2-1’ home win against AFC Bournemouth.

Souleymane Bamba scored in injury-time for Cardiff City to double their wins in the league with a ‘2-1’ victory against a 10-man Brighton & Hove Albion side.

(5 defeats and a draw)Crystal Palace went 6 league matches without a win after a ’1-0’ defeat at home to Tottenham.

An emotional home game for Leicester City ended in a stalemate with Burnley. It was Leicester City’s first game at the King Power Stadium since the tragic death of their owner/chairman.

Three teams are threatening Arsenal’s 2004 ‘invincible’ season. Manchester City, Liverpool, and Chelsea remain unbeaten in the league after 12 matches.
Fulham is locked at the bottom of the league table after an expected ‘2-0’ defeat to Liverpool.
Arsenal and Chelsea stretched their unbeaten run in the league after getting a point at home in their respective matches. Chelsea was held to a goalless draw by Everton while Arsenal had to get a late goal to avoid a defeat against Wolverhampton.

Manchester is Blue – Manchester United fell 12 points behind their city rivals after being out-classed in the Manchester Derby.
Manchester City comfortably come out victorious in the Manchester Derby to remain unbeaten in the league and top of the standings after a ‘3-1’ win over Manchester United. Sergio Aguero’s match winning goal made him the leading scorer in the league with 8 goals.
